1. 程式人生 > 實用技巧 >Linux入門

Linux入門

Linux入門

1.作業系統有哪些?各系統分別作用於什麼領域?
Windows、macOS、Linux、移動(iOS、Android)
(1)Windows、Linux可以用於伺服器作業系統,也可以用於桌面作業系統,其中伺服器作業系統中Linux佔比高,桌面作業系統中Windows佔比高
(2)Linux也可以用於嵌入式開發
(3)macOS用於桌面作業系統,開發人員佔比高

2.虛擬機器的作用是什麼?虛擬機器軟體有哪幾個?
(1)(Virtual Machine)可以通過軟體模擬具有完整硬體系統功能並且能夠執行在一個完全隔離環境中的完整計算機系統
(2)VirtualBox、VMware等

3.vim編輯器有哪些模式?各模式下可以執行哪些操

作?分別有哪些指令
(1)一般模式、編輯模式、指令模式各模式之間可以切換;
(2)一般模式:預設的模式,可以進行刪除、複製、貼上等的動作,無法編輯檔案內容;編輯模式:按下『i, I, o, O, a, A, r, R』等進入編輯模式,可以編輯檔案內容;指令模式:可以搜尋、存檔、字元替換、離開 vim 、顯示行號等動作
(3)vim具體命令參照課件

4.B語言和C語言哪個可移植性更好?
C語言
5.常見的Linux發行版有哪些?
Ubuntu、Redhat、Fedora、openSUSE、Debian、Centos等

6.Linux核心版和發行版分別指什麼?
核心版:是執行程式和管理像磁碟和印表機等硬體裝置的核心程式,他提供了在裸裝置與應用程式間的抽象層;有穩定版和開發版,並且核心由開發者參與研發和維護。

**發行版:桌面作業系統,通常包含了桌面環境、辦公套件、媒體播放器、資料庫等應用軟體,發行版是基於核心版實現的。** 
  • 1

7.linux關機和重啟、檢視IP地址、檢視主機名命令是?
reboot、halt、ifconfig、hostname
8.Linux的常見目錄有哪些?分別存放什麼內容?
bin、sbin、root、home、usr、etc、tmp、boot、opt、mnt、等,目錄存放內容從課件找對於的答案

9.centos 網絡卡絕對路徑是?
/etc/sysconfig/network-scripts/ifcfg-eth0